Ukucaciswa Kwepayipi kwe-ASTM A335 P22 (Chrome Moly Pipe)

Ingemuva Lobunjiniyela

 

Phakathi kwazo zonke izinsimbi ze-Cr-Mo alloy,I-ASTM A335 Ibanga P22imele esinye sezixazululo eziguquguqukayo kakhulu zeamapayipi{{0}aphezulu{1}}nezinga lokushisa eliphezulu.
Ihlanganisa2.25% chromiumfuthi1% molybdenum, ukwakha i-alloy matrix ekwazi ukumelana nokukhasa, i-oxidation, kanye ne-carburization ngesikhathi sokuchayeka isikhathi eside emazingeni okushisa afinyelela ku-620℃(1150℃F).

Le nto kade yaba yi-ihhashi lomsebenzi wokuphehla ugesi, indawo yokuhlanza, kanye nezinhlelo zamapayipi e-petrochemical, ukuvala igebe lokusebenza phakathi kwamabanga aphansi njenge-P11 nama-ferritic athuthukisiwe{1}}ama-martensitic alloys afana ne-P91.
Ibhalansi yayo yokwethembeka kwemishini, ukwakheka, kanye{0}}nokuqina kwesikhathi eside kuyenza ilungeleizihloko zesitimu, amashubhu okushisa kabusha, kanye{0}}nemigqa yokudlulisa izinga lokushisa eliphezulu.

 

 

I-alloy Design kanye ne-Metallurgical Fundamentals

 

UGrade P22 ungowakwa-isigaba se-ferriticzezinsimbi. Ukusebenza kwayo kuphuma ku-microstructure eyakhiwe ngokunembilei-ferrite ethukuthele kanye ne-chromium–molybdenum carbides ezinzile (M₂₃C₆, M₆C).

I-alloy Element Okuqukethwe (%) Iqhaza Ekusebenzeni
I-Cr (Chromium) 1.90 – 2.60 Yakha isendlalelo se-oxide esivikelayo futhi ithuthukise ukumelana nokukala
I-Mo (Molybdenum) 0.87 – 1.13 Inikeza{0}}isixazululo esiqinile sokuqiniswa kanye nokumelana nokukhuphuka
C (Ikhabhoni) 0.05 – 0.15 Ilawula ubulukhuni kanye nebhalansi ye-ductility
Mn (Manganese) 0.30 – 0.60 Ithuthukisa ukushisela nokuqina
I-Si (Silicon) 0.50 – 1.00 Ithuthukisa ukumelana ne-oxidation nokugqwala
P / S Ngaphansi noma kulingana no-0.025 Igcina i-ductility futhi ivimbele ukubola komngcele wokusanhlamvu

Lokhu kumiswa kwe-metallurgical kuqinisekisa:

  • I-ferrite ezinzile{0}}i-carbide microstructureukumelana nokuqina ngaphansi komthwalo oshisayo.
  • Creep-ukuzinza kokuqhekekaamahora esevisi angaphezu kuka-100,000 ku-540-600 degree.
  • Ubuqotho be-weld obuhle kakhululapho-ukushisa kwe-weld{1}}kwelashwa (PWHT).
  • Ukukala kwe-oxidation okulawulwayo, kunciphisa ukuhwalala kwe-tube surface kanye nokumoshakala kwensimbi.

 

Ubuqotho Bemishini kanye Nokumelana Nezinga lokushisa

 

 

Impahla Imfuneko Inhloso yobunjiniyela
Amandla Okuqina Kukhulu noma kulingana no-415 MPa (60 ksi) Imelana{0}}nengcindezi yesikhathi eside ye-axial
Isivuno Amandla Kukhulu noma kulingana no-205 MPa (30 ksi) Ivimbela ukubola kwepulasitiki
Ukwelula Kukhulu noma kulingana no-30% Inikeza i-ductility yokwenziwa
Ukuqina Ngaphansi noma kulingana nokuthi 163 HBW Iqinisekisa ukuqina kwe-weld kanye nokumelana nokukhathala

Emazingeni okushisa aphakeme, i-P22 igcina i-akhasa-amandla okuphuka angaphezu kuka-60 MPa ngo-600 degree, igcina isimo sayo nobuqotho ngisho nangaphansi kwengcindezi yomjikelezo nokudlidliza.

 

Ubuchwepheshe Bokukhiqiza Nokwelashwa Kokushisa

 

Ngokungafani nezinsimbi eziphansi zekhabhoni, i-P22 idinga ukunembaukulawulwa kwe-thermal-mechanicalkukho konke ukukhiqiza.
I-Octal Pipe isebenzisa amasu okubumba angenamthungo ahlanganiswe neukwelashwa-okuningi kokushisaukuqinisekisa ukufana kwe-metallurgical nokunemba kobukhulu.

Umzila Wokukhiqiza:

  • Ukubhoboza Ibhilidi & Ukwakhiwa Okushisayo– Cr-Mo billets abhobozwa ku-1100–1150℃kusetshenziswa i-rotary extrusion.
  • Umdwebo Obandayo / Ukuginqika Okushisayo- Icolisa usayizi wokusanhlamvu nokufana kodonga.
  • Ukujwayela (940-980 degree)- Icwenga okusanhlamvu okusanhlamvu futhi incibilikisa ama-carbides ahlukanisiwe.
  • Ukushisa (675-760 degree)- Ikhulula izingcindezi zangaphakathi, ibuyisela i-ductility, futhi iqinise ama-carbides.
  • Ukuhlolwa kwe-Hydrostatic / Ultrasonic- Iqinisekisa amandla okucindezela nomsindo wesakhiwo.

Iukwelashwa kokushisa-okukabili(i-normalize + temper) ibalulekile. Iveza -i-matrix ye-ferrite ehlanzekile, eqinile emelana ne-embrittlement, igcina i-weld ductility, futhi inikeza ukusebenza okucatshangelwayo okubikezelwayo phakathi namashumi eminyaka esevisi.

Ukusebenza Ngaphansi Kwezinga Lokushisa Eliphakeme

 

Ezimweni zokusebenza ezingaphezu kuka-550 degree, i-P22 yenza aungqimba oluminyene lwe-Cr₂O₃ oxideenamathela kusisekelo sensimbi, evimbela ukubola nokulahlekelwa kwensimbi.
Le filimu isebenza njenge-a{0}}isithiyo sokuziphilisa, igcina ukusebenza kahle kokudlulisa ukushisa kanye nokushelela kwendawo kukho konke ukuchayeka isikhathi eside.

Izici zokusebenza ezibalulekile:

  • Amandla e-Creep aphezulu:Izinzile ngaphansi komthwalo oqhubekayo nokuhamba ngengcindezi.
  • Ukumelana Ne-Thermal Fatigue:I-fine-i-matrix esanhlamvu ivimbela ukuqhekeka ngaphansi kwemijikelezo yokunwetshwa.
  • Ukuzinza kweDimensional:Ukwandiswa kwe-thermal ephansi kuqinisekisa ukuhambisana kwe-weld okungaguquki.
  • Ukusebenza kwe-Weld:I-PWHT ibuyisela i-ductility futhi iqede ingcindezi eyinsalela.
  • Ukumelana ne-Oxidation:Ukuvikelwa okuthembekile kufika ku-620℃, okunweba izikhawu zokuhlola.

 

Ukuqaliswa Kwezimboni

 

I-ASTM A335 P22 alloy pipe isatshalaliswa kabanzi kuukukhiqiza amandla, i-petrochemical, futhiukucwengaimikhakha, ikakhulukazi kui-superheater, i-reheater, kanye{0}}namasekhethi e-feedwater anomfutho ophezulu.

Izicelo ezimele abanye:

  • I-Boiler & Reheater Tubingamayunithi angaphansi kanye ne-supercritical.
  • Cubungula izihloko ze-Steamfuthiabezomnothoezitshalweni zikagesi.
  • Imishini yokucwenga kanye ne-Petrochemical Furnaceslapho kuhlangana khona amagesi e-carburizing kanye ne-oxidizing.
  • Amagobolondo okushintsha ukushisafuthiizinguquko eziningikudinga{0}}ukuzinza kwe-metallurgical yesikhathi eside.

Irekhodi layo lenkonzo kungqalasizinda yamandla liqinisekisa ukufaneleka kwayoukusebenza okuqhubekayo kanye nesikhathi esincane sokuphumula, okwenza i-P22 ibe into ebalulekile ezitshalweni{1}}ezisebenza kahle emhlabeni wonke.

Q1: Lisetshenziselwa ini ipayipi le-ASTM A335 P22 (ASME SA335 P22)?

A1:Izinga lokushisa eliphezulu-eliphezulu,{1}}eliphezulu{1}}amapayipi esevisi yokucindezela ezimbonini zikagesi, izindawo zokuhluza, namayunithi e-petrochemical.

Q2: Iluphi uhlelo lwe-alloy olujwayelekile lwepayipi le-P22?

A2:I-2.25Cr-1Mo (i-chrome-moly) insimbi ye-ferritic alloy edizayinelwe ukukhasa kanye nokumelana ne-oxidation.

I-Q3: Yikuphi ukwelashwa okushisa okuvame ukudingeka kupayipi le-P22?

A3:Ukushisa nokushisa okujwayelekile (N+T) ngamarekhodi okwelapha okushisa abhaliwe{1}}.

Q4: Kufanele ngikhethe nini i-P22 esikhundleni se-P11 noma i-P91?

A4:Khetha i-P22 njengebanga eliphakathi-elilinganayo lezinga lokushisa eliphakeme/elikhuphukayo kune-P11, kodwa ngaphandle kwezindleko/izilawuli eziphakeme ngokuvamile ezihlotshaniswa ne-P91.

Q5: Yini okufanele ngiyicele ukuze ngiqinisekise ikhwalithi yepayipi le-P22 ngaphambi kokuthenga?

A5:ZU 10204 3.1/3.2 MTC enokulandeleka kokushisa, imiphumela yemishini/yekhemistri, ubulukhuni, nokuhlolwa kwe-hydrostatic noma kwe-UT njengoba kucacisiwe.
